Jason Massie

Founder & President

As Founder and President of MASSIE R&D Tax Credits, Jason is responsible for the quality, consistency and integrity of our tax credit service offerings. He heads the Delivery Team at MASSIE and leads all Architecture and Controversy Phases for clients across the United States. He received a B.S. in Accounting from Christian Brothers University and a law degree from the University of Memphis. He was first introduced to R&D Tax Credits during his time at a Big 6 accounting firm in Washington, D.C. Over the next few years, he led Big 4 and law firm practices in managing many types of federal and state tax planning, credits, incentives and other cash flow strategies. He is widely recognized as an expert by his peers in the R&D Tax Credit and R&D Expenditure areas, with frequent speaking and writing engagements.
